Unit price perA top notch landscape shrub featuring a dense, upright habit, Hick's Yew makes a great low maintenance hedge. After emerging bright green in spring, the ferny leaves turn dark green and remain so throughout the winter. The plant also features fruit of the red drupe variety. Hick's Yew is one of the only evergreens that loves shade.

Unit price perAlso known as Eastern White Pine, this highly attractive columnar tree has silky smooth long needles which give a fuzzy appearance from a distance. It is known to attract birds to your yard. It grows at a fast rate, and under ideal conditions can be expected to live to a ripe old age of 100 years or more. Give it some shelter as it will sometimes get windburn in exposed locations.

Unit price perThis semi-evergreen azalea is an ideal choice for the mixed border as well as front foundation plantings due to its compact, mounded habit and pretty pale lilac-rose flowers in early spring. The foliage is bright green, turning shade of orange and red in the fall. Will shed lower lower leaves in winter. To ensure success this plant must have loose, acidic soil that drains well, and will fail in wet, heavy, poorly draining clay. Amend heavy clay soil with shredded pine bark and add soil sulfur to lower the pH. Flower bud hardy to -25F.
